Patents
Patents for G06F 9 - Arrangements for programme control, e.g. control unit (241,428)
02/2006
02/14/2006US7000204 Power estimation based on power characterizations
02/14/2006US7000203 Efficient and comprehensive method to calculate IC package or PCB trace mutual inductance using circular segments and lookup tables
02/14/2006US7000202 Method of vector generation for estimating performance of integrated circuit designs
02/14/2006US7000196 Data item list display apparatus, data item list display method, and computer-readable recording medium recorded with data item list display program
02/14/2006US7000192 Method of producing a matted image usable in a scrapbook
02/14/2006US7000190 System and method for programmatically modifying a graphical program in response to program information
02/14/2006US7000187 Method and apparatus for software technical support and training
02/14/2006US7000153 Computer apparatus and method of diagnosing the computer apparatus and replacing, repairing or adding hardware during non-stop operation of the computer apparatus
02/14/2006US7000151 System and method for providing run-time type checking
02/14/2006US7000137 System for and method of clock cycle-time analysis using mode-slicing mechanism
02/14/2006US7000135 Clock control method and information processing device employing the clock control method
02/14/2006US7000132 Signal-initiated power management method for a pipelined data processor
02/14/2006US7000124 Power management device of an electronic card
02/14/2006US7000108 System, apparatus and method for presentation and manipulation of personal information syntax objects
02/14/2006US7000103 Method for updating a system BIOS by reading a BIOS stored in an IDE-interface connected to a hard disk drive
02/14/2006US7000102 Platform and method for supporting hibernate operations
02/14/2006US7000101 System and method for updating BIOS for a multiple-node computer system
02/14/2006US7000099 Large table vectorized lookup by selecting entries of vectors resulting from permute operations on sub-tables
02/14/2006US7000098 Passing a received packet for modifying pipelining processing engines' routine instructions
02/14/2006US7000097 System and method for handling load and/or store operations in a superscalar microprocessor
02/14/2006US7000096 Branch prediction circuits and methods and systems using the same
02/14/2006US7000095 Method and apparatus for clearing hazards using jump instructions
02/14/2006US7000094 Storing stack operands in registers
02/14/2006US7000091 System and method for independent branching in systems with plural processing elements
02/14/2006US7000089 Address assignment to transaction for serialization
02/14/2006US7000087 Programmatically pre-selecting specific physical memory blocks to allocate to an executing application
02/14/2006US7000081 Write back and invalidate mechanism for multiple cache lines
02/14/2006US7000075 Software management systems and methods for automotive computing devices
02/14/2006US7000072 Cache memory allocation method
02/14/2006US7000071 Method for virtually enlarging the stack of a portable data carrier
02/14/2006US7000067 Virtual expansion of program RAM size
02/14/2006US7000052 System and method for configuring and deploying input/output cards in a communications environment
02/14/2006US7000051 Apparatus and method for virtualizing interrupts in a logically partitioned computer system
02/14/2006US7000050 Apparatus, method and program for contention arbitration
02/14/2006US7000048 Apparatus and method for parallel processing of network data on a single processing thread
02/14/2006US7000047 Mechanism for effectively handling livelocks in a simultaneous multithreading processor
02/14/2006US7000034 Function interface system and method of processing issued functions between co-processors
02/14/2006US7000026 Multi-channel sharing in a high-capacity network
02/14/2006US7000022 Flow of streaming data through multiple processing modules
02/14/2006US6999997 Method and apparatus for communication of message data using shared queues
02/14/2006US6999995 Console redirection system for remotely controlling operation of devices on a host computer if data packet has been received during a time interval
02/14/2006US6999994 Hardware device for processing the tasks of an algorithm in parallel
02/14/2006US6999990 Technical support chain automation with guided self-help capability, escalation to live help, and active journaling
02/14/2006US6999985 Single instruction multiple data processing
02/14/2006US6999976 Method, apparatus, and program for using a Java archive to encode a file system delta
02/14/2006US6999964 Support for domain level business object keys in EJB
02/14/2006US6999913 Emulated read-write disk drive using a protected medium
02/14/2006US6999912 Provisioning computing services via an on-line networked computing environment
02/14/2006US6999350 Data line disturbance free memory block divided flash memory and microcomputer having flash memory therein
02/14/2006US6999102 Framework for objects having authorable behaviors and appearances
02/14/2006US6999082 Character code converting system in multi-platform environment, and computer readable recording medium having recorded character code converting program
02/14/2006US6999042 Low visual impact monopole tower for wireless communications
02/14/2006US6998892 Method and apparatus for accommodating delay variations among multiple signals
02/14/2006CA2348261C Program product and data processor
02/09/2006WO2006015352A2 System and method for creating distributed application
02/09/2006WO2006015006A2 Generating software components from business rules expressed in a natural language
02/09/2006WO2006014892A2 Generating a database model from natural language expressions of business rules
02/09/2006WO2006014721A2 Automatic authorization of programmatic transactions
02/09/2006WO2006014388A2 Optimized chaining of vertex and fragment programs
02/09/2006WO2006014354A2 Method and system for concurrent excution of mutiple kernels
02/09/2006WO2006014332A2 Method and system for more precisely linking metadata and digital images
02/09/2006WO2006013992A1 Network system, management computer, cluster management method, and computer program
02/09/2006WO2006013953A1 Image processing apparatus and control method thereof
02/09/2006WO2006013857A1 Information processing device
02/09/2006WO2006013438A1 A system and method for specifying virtual machines
02/09/2006WO2006013279A2 Processor time-sharing method
02/09/2006WO2006013204A1 Method for updating resident software in different appliances and appliances adapted to be updated by same
02/09/2006WO2006013158A2 Managing resources in a data processing system
02/09/2006WO2006013157A1 Method and apparatus for discovering hardware in a data processing system
02/09/2006WO2006013113A2 Method for managing storage area in a portable radio communication equipment
02/09/2006WO2006013112A2 Compact storage of program code on mobile terminals
02/09/2006WO2006012742A1 Method for compiling and executing a parallel program
02/09/2006WO2006002040A3 Variants in graphical modeling environments
02/09/2006WO2005114370A3 System and method for multiple document interface
02/09/2006WO2005111939A3 Model 3d construction application program interface
02/09/2006WO2005109848A3 System and method to conditionally shrink an executable module
02/09/2006WO2005076857A3 Systems and methods for interfacing object identifier readers to multiple types of applications
02/09/2006WO2005069128A3 Uml-model based requirement traceability method
02/09/2006WO2005062167A3 Transitioning from instruction cache to trace cache on label boundaries
02/09/2006WO2005059748A3 Apparatus, system, and method for on-demand control of grid system resources
02/09/2006WO2005045559A3 Model-based management of computer systems and distributed applications
02/09/2006WO2005033899A3 Method and apparatus for scheduling resources on a switched underlay network
02/09/2006WO2005013118A3 Renaming for register with multiple bit fields
02/09/2006WO2004061660A3 A user-centric service providing device and service providing method
02/09/2006US20060031935 System and method for computer security
02/09/2006US20060031918 System and method for describing presentation and behavior information in an ITV application
02/09/2006US20060031856 Method and system for managing software components
02/09/2006US20060031855 System and method for runtime interface versioning
02/09/2006US20060031854 Systems and methods for tracking screen updates
02/09/2006US20060031853 System and method for optimizing processing speed to run multiple dialogs between multiple users and a virtual agent
02/09/2006US20060031852 Virtualization of control software for communication devices
02/09/2006US20060031851 Quiescence mode
02/09/2006US20060031850 System and method for a Web service virtual interface
02/09/2006US20060031849 User task interface in a Web application
02/09/2006US20060031848 Managing data received from processes of a distributed computing arrangement
02/09/2006US20060031847 Multi-layer protocol reassembly that operates independently of underlying protocols, and resulting vector list corresponding thereto
02/09/2006US20060031846 Clustered enterprise JavaTM in a secure distributed processing system
02/09/2006US20060031845 Techniques for providing services and establishing processing environments
02/09/2006US20060031844 Techniques for accessing a shared resource using an improved synchronization mechanism
02/09/2006US20060031843 Cluster system and method for operating cluster nodes